Overall GPAs at graduation are usually a little higher than after the first year, because students have more of an opportunity to take classes where there aren't strictly forced curves, classes they might excel more at, etc. How this applies to specific schools and individual students varies, but it's common to expect that the "cut off" GPAs for various percentiles will move up slightly by graduation.uzpakalis wrote:How do 1L rankings compare to graduation rankings?
